RailFair Show Offers Relaxing Experience With Trains

Published: December 26, 2007

TAMPA - Most of our experiences with trains involve being stopped at crossing gates on State Road 60 between Tampa and Brandon, or along other east Hillsborough County roads, usually during rush hour and often accompanied by a spike in our blood pressure because of the delay.

But another experience with trains was offered at the Florida State Fairgrounds on Dec. 15, the kind more likely to lower blood pressure than raise it. The RailFair Model Train Show drew train enthusiasts and dealers from across the country.

Everyone from wide-eyed children to serious train hobbyists mingled among 320 dealer tables and several detailed and elaborate train layouts. Everything from whole train sets, individual locomotives and cars, books, memorabilia and accessories were available in all sizes, from the large, garden-sized G-gauge to O-gauge, and the most common HO-scale, N-gauge and tiny Z-gauge.

"It was one of the best shows we've had this year," said Bill Hollash Jr., owner of Hollash Trains in Riverview. Hollash, who worked his large setup with the help of his wife, Jean, son Michael and father Bill Senior, credited event organizer Charlie Miller of Virginia with the success of the show.

"He put a lot of effort into this," said Hollash, who's been in the train business for 12 years after working with his dad in chicken farming for 31 years.

"We do O-gauge," Hollash said, "Lionel-sized stuff. We do a lot of mail-order and shows, mainly. I like O-gauge, so that's what we're into."

The layouts were the most eye-popping aspect of the show, with handmade trees, intricately detailed bridges, realistic streams and lakes and buildings painted to appear weatherbeaten and worn.
